Some tips for your application 🫡
Tailor Your CV: Make sure your CV highlights relevant experience in customer service, sales support, or B2B account management. Emphasise any background in biology, cosmetic science, or chemistry, as these are preferred qualifications for the role.
Craft a Compelling Cover Letter: In your cover letter, clearly outline your relevant experience and how it aligns with the responsibilities of the Product Development Coordinator role. Mention your organisational skills and 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.
Showcase Communication Skills: Since excellent written communication is key for this position, ensure your application is free from errors and clearly conveys your message. Use professional language and structure your documents well.
Highlight Teamwork and Initiative: Demonstrate your cooperative and team-oriented nature in both your CV and cover letter. Provide examples of how you've successfully worked within a team and taken initiative in previous roles.
How to prepare for a job interview at Workvine
✨Know the Company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ure to research The Secrets of Caledonia thoroughly. Understand their products, values, and the market they operate in.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.
✨Demonstrate Your Communication Skills
As a Product Development Coordinator, clear communication is key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you successfully handled customer inquiries or collaborated with teams. Highlight your ability to convey technical information clearly and professionally.
✨Showcase Your Organisational Skills
Given the fast-paced environment, it's crucial to demonstrate your organisational abilities. Be ready to discuss how you prioritise tasks and manage your time effectively. Consider sharing specific tools or methods you use to stay organised.
✨Emphasise Your Team Player Attitude
The role requires a cooperative and team-oriented mindset. Prepare to discuss instances where you've worked collaboratively in a team setting. Highlight your openness to diverse perspectives and how you contribute to a positive team dynamic.
